One prominent scholar who worked on the concept of the "struggle of races" was Arthur de Gobineau. He was a French diplomat, writer, and ethnologist who is best known for his work "An Essay on the Inequality of the Human Races" (1853–1855), in which he argued that the Aryan race was superior to all others and that racial mixing would lead to the decline of civilizations. Gobineau's ideas had a significant influence on later racial theorists and thinkers, including those who espoused racist ideologies such as Nazism.
